Canton man faces possessing child pornography charges

CANTON — State Police in the Computer Crime Unit have arrested a Canton man for possessing child pornography.

Jeremy T. Dissottle, 27, was charged with promotion of a sexual performance by a child and possession of a sexual performance by a child stemming form an incident that occurred in June 2022.

Police responded to Ellis Road in the town of Canton for a report of an individual allegedly accessing child sexual abuse material over the internet.

Police say the investigation determined Dissottle had obtained and viewed child sexual abuse material.

Dissottle was issued appearance tickets returnable in Town of Potsdam Court for December 7.

State Police were assisted by Homeland Security Investigations and the Federal Bureau of Investigation.
